Abstract (en)

[origin: WO2014135817A1] The present invention concerns an electroconductive support (100 to 300) for an OLED comprising, in the following order: • - a glass substrate (1), • - a metal grid (2) electrode with strands (20), • - an electrically insulating light extraction layer (41), under the metal grid (2) • - a layer (3) of which the thickness is partially structured, of a given composition; of refraction index n 3 from 1.7 to 2.3, which is on the light extraction layer, said partially structured layer being formed • - from a structured region (31), with cavities at least partially containing the metal grid, • - of another region, called the low region (30), on the light extraction layer. The difference H between the so-called top surface, i.e. that which is furthest from the substrate, of the structured region (31) and the so-called upper surface, i.e. that which is furthest from the substrate, of the metal grid (2) is, as an absolute value, less than or equal to 100nm.
